I was mainly lokking for a headphone with a mic built in but thanks. Still, isnt thier problems with vista and sounblasters?
Yes. For one, EAX will not work as the sound stack or whatever its called in Vista was rewritten to make it more stable and reliable. Creative created a workaround for this, though, but it only works for a couple of games. It's called Alchemy. Another caveat is that Creative's Vista drivers, at the moment, are pretty ****ty. They're making progress, but at a very slow pace. How slow? Well, a third-party from China was able to make better drivers than the manufacturer of the soundcard. I believe they're called YOU-PAX. I've used my Creative X-Fi XtremeMusic in Vista and the sound quality was noticeably worse when compared to XP. Also, I encountered some audio bugs in games like Supreme Commander where sounds are fuzzy and crackle.
